logo

Output 8de88eece62cb7567c5666f52c7eb1dcafc1ec48883ad7328caeb786ade43050:1

value
14852664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ff17c45b0a081a830648589ce15750797dbae1ef OP_EQUAL
address
3Qwphpc8Ufz92BKYaYtKdpDzquH43qBjky
transaction
8de88eece62cb7567c5666f52c7eb1dcafc1ec48883ad7328caeb786ade43050